vfp中使用pack命令时的它说文件已在另一工作区中打开,但是我把所有的文件都关闭了,只剩下一个,为什么
你好啊,我在网上搜索答案的时候发现了你曾经回答过这个问题,你说这与文件独占没有关系,要关闭原来已经打开的文件,但是我关闭了所有的文件,只剩下这一个数据库,并且已经把数据库...
你好啊,我在网上搜索答案的时候发现了你曾经回答过这个问题,你说这与文件独占没有关系,要关闭原来已经打开的文件,但是我关闭了所有的文件,只剩下这一个数据库,并且已经把数据库设置为独占形式,为什么还是说文件已经在另一工作区被打开,,,求解答呢,
展开
展开全部
VF提示“文件已经在另一工作区被打开”,并非光指在当前VF系统中打开,还可能在其他VF系统中打开,也有可能被其他软件使用着,VF的这个提示只能说明,VF没有修改这个表的权利。
追问
那要怎样才能关闭呢,使用close all这个命令吗
追答
如果CLOSE ALL后还不能PACK的话,很有可能是其他软件正在打开这个文件,也有可能是内存中有一个VFP系统没有退出,你可以到WINDOWS任务管理器查看并将进程退出。再有可能,如果在共享文件夹中,被其他用户打开。
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询